It is the ratio of the work done(W)and the time taken(t). Power is defined as the rate of doing work. A 60-W light bulb, for example, expends 60 J of energy per second. Because work is energy transfer, power is also the rate at which energy is expended. The SI unit for power is the watt W, where 1 watt equals 1 joule/second (1W=1J/s). Sometimes the power of motor vehicles and other machines is given in terms of Horsepower (hp), which is approximately equal to 745.7 watts. The SI unit of power is Watt (W) which is joules per second (J/s).
